Valent BioSciences Corporation Announces Construction of a New Biorational Research Center
BusinessWire - Mon Apr 18, 8:00AM CDT
Valent BioSciences Corporation (VBC) has announced plans to construct a new state of the art Biorational Research Center (BRC) as an expansion of its current presence in Libertyville, IL. Part of a larger scale R&D investment plan being employed by parent Sumitomo Chemical Company (SCC), the VBC project includes an approximately 65,000 square foot build-out for dedicated lab and office space and an additional 20,000 square feet of greenhouse space at Innovation Park. VBC becomes the first occupant at the new 1.2 million square foot multi-tenant facility in Lake County, IL, just north of Chicago.
Valent BioSciences Corporation and Rizobacter Enter R&D Cooperation Agreement for Biorationals
BusinessWire - Thu Mar 31, 10:00AM CDT
Valent BioSciences Corporation (VBC) announced today it has signed a long-term cooperation agreement with Rizobacter for R&D collaboration in the BioRational Rhizosphere space - initially for the NAFTA region. The alliance will further accelerate VBC's development and commercialization of new microbial products for the root zone as part of its expanding seed and soil strategy. Driving the strategic partnership is the increasing need to accelerate the research and development of sustainable agriculture solutions to feed a growing world population.

JCI Announces New Commitment to The Million Nets Pledge
Marketwired - Wed Mar 30, 6:00AM CDT
Last Thursday (March 24, 2016), JCI announced that it will help the United Nations Foundation's Nothing But Nets campaign provide 30,000 life-saving bed nets for refugees in Africa, protecting families from malaria. JCI will activate its more than 200,000 members across the country and around the world to raise the funds, create awareness, and advocate this year, the second and final year of The Million Nets Pledge. If the funds are raised, it will unlock a match from Nothing But Nets partner Sumitomo Chemical Company, doubling the amount of nets to 60,000 to help protect more refugees from malaria.
Valent BioSciences Corporation Reaches Global Licensing Agreement with LidoChem, Inc. for New Biocontrol Technology to Protect Against Nematodes
BusinessWire - Mon Mar 28, 10:00AM CDT
Valent BioSciences Corporation (VBC) announced today it has reached a global licensing agreement with LidoChem, Inc. for a novel, patented biocontrol technology for use in corn, soybean, and other crops. Based on a unique strain of the beneficial soil microorganism Bacillus amyloliquefaciens, it will be developed by VBC in collaboration with Valent U.S.A. Corporation. VBC and Valent U.S.A. are wholly-owned subsidiaries of Sumitomo Chemical, a global leader of conventional plant protection and biorational technologies for agriculture.

The increased regulations on the usage of persistent organic pollutants (POPs) is anticipated to fuel the growth of the market during the forecast period. POPs are chemicals that are resistant to environmental degradation and accumulate in the food chain. The 2001 Stockholm Convention on? Persistent Organic Pollutants banned the use of POPs, such as DDT, and any kind of insecticide and pesticide that can act as a pollutant for agricultural purposes as they pose severe risks to human and animal health. This initiative has led to the use of environmentally friendly insecticides that can undergo biodegradation and have minimal impact on the environment such as pyrethrums and pyrethroids. The synthetic crop protection chemicals dominated the market with a share of 92% during 2014. These chemicals can be further classified as organophosphate pesticides, carbamate pesticides, organochlorine insecticides, and pyrethroids.
